The annual Parker’s Purpose Dinner and Grand Auction will be held June 17 at the Ole Zim’s Wagon Shed in Gibsonburg. Parker’s Purpose is a foundation whose mission is to give assistance to children who are ill or disabled and whose family is in an immediate financial crisis.

Last year’s auction raised $17,000 and helped 14 families.

This year’s event starts at 5 p.m. and dinner is at 6 p.m.

Howard was the 1991 Heisman trophy winner from the University of Michigan, the 1997 Super Bowl MVP for the Green Bay Packers, and is a current member of ESPNs College Gameday staff.

Tickets for the event are $50 and tables of 8 are available for $350. Only 400 tickets are available.

Parker’s Purpose is currently asking for donation items, gift certificates, and monetary donations for the event.
